Javascript 多重:vue中的值

Javascript 多重:vue中的值,javascript,vue.js,Javascript,Vue.js,我有一个接受值并将其与其他表单一起发送到我的后端的程序 {{ 银行名称 }} 但在发送之前,我需要获取一些数据,使用bank.id填充第二个选择框,我应该在上面的代码中使用:value=“bank.id” 要获取用于进行填充第二个选择框的api调用的值,我只需执行以下操作 var branch=document.getElementById('branch').value; 并在API调用中使用它 但是在这里,我需要获取bank.id来进行第一个api调用,该调用填充selectbox,

我有一个接受值并将其与其他表单一起发送到我的后端的程序


{{ 
银行名称
}}
但在发送之前,我需要获取一些数据,使用
bank.id
填充第二个选择框,我应该在上面的代码中使用
:value=“bank.id”

要获取用于进行填充第二个选择框的api调用的值,我只需执行以下操作

var branch=document.getElementById('branch').value;
并在API调用中使用它

但是在这里,我需要获取
bank.id
来进行第一个api调用,该调用填充selectbox,并且仍然将
bank.code
作为表单数据提交


我曾考虑过使用javascript获取
,javascript具有
bank.id
。但无法计算它应该如何工作或以不同的方式工作。

解决此问题的一个方法是将整个
银行
对象绑定到您的
模型

然后,您可以使用其
id
填充其他选择选项,并使用其
code
构建表单数据负载

比如说


{{ 
银行名称
}}
数据:()=>({
表格数据:{
//不管你原来在这里有什么
},
selectedBank:{}//空对象或默认银行
}),
方法:{
getBranch(){
const bankId=this.selectedBank.id
//进行API调用等
},
提交形式(){
//构建表单数据
常量formData={
…此.formData,
开户银行:this.selectedBank.code
}
//提交表格等
}
}

请参见

是否可以绑定数据属性<代码>:databank id=“bank.id”您能否更新问题以显示您所描述的内容?最有效的解决方案可能取决于第二个
select
如何绑定到表单数据和提交方法中。@Daniel_Knights这正是我要寻找的。添加该选项,然后获得所选选项的属性。